The Rise and Progress of Ships and Steamships: Including the Trade of Liverpool is a historical account of the evolution of ships and steamships by William Blood. Published in 1883, the book traces the development of ships from the earliest times to the mid-19th century, with a particular focus on the steamship revolution. The author provides a detailed analysis of the technological advancements that led to the rise of steam-powered ships and their impact on the shipping industry. The book also includes a comprehensive overview of the trade of Liverpool, one of the most important ports in the world during the 19th century.
